Aimed at
Pharmacy teams and pre-registration pharmacists completing their training.
What’s Covered
· Emergency Actions
· Child, Baby & Adult Basic Life Support (CPR)
· Child, Baby & Adult Choking
· How to use a defib (AED)
· Electric Shock
· Diabetes (high & low blood sugar)
· Abdominal pain
· Unconsciousness & Recovery Position
· Bleeding, Eye Injuries & Burns
· Injuries to the Bones, Muscles & Joints
· Seizures/Fitting
· Anaphylaxis
· Heart Attacks
· Head Injuries & Concussion
· Poisoning
. First Aider Responsibilities
